vpnc “Redes de destino” e opções de DNSUpdate não funcionam

1

A documentação do VPNC descreve as opções para restringir a rota de conexão VPN a um intervalo de IPs e também deixar a configuração de DNS do sistema intocada.

Minha configuração vpnc (/etc/conf/default.conf) contém as seguintes linhas:

Target networks 192.168.103.0/24
DNSUpdate no

Esses trabalhos são esperados / descritos acima no Ubuntu 9.10, mas em certas versões do CentOS e OpenSuSE, rodando

$vpnc /etc/conf/default.conf

resulta no seguinte:

vpnc: warning: unknown configuration directive in /etc/vpnc/swisscom.conf at line ##

para ambas as linhas mencionadas acima.

A versão vpnc é 0.5.3 em todos os sistemas.

Alguém conseguiu resolver esse problema?

Obrigado v.

    
por tishma 29.11.2010 / 15:59

1 resposta

3

De uma citação do arquivo README.Debian:

ATUALIZAR NOTAS

Se você estiver usando extensões específicas do Debian com "Redes de destino" e Directivas "DNSupdate", considere mudar a sua práxis para usar o caminho de configuração upstream agora. Veja o arquivo /usr/share/doc/vpnc/README.gz para detalhes sobre a substituição de rotas de rede com as personalizadas usando as variáveis de vpnc-script. Você pode envolver / etc / vpnc / vpnc-script em um script personalizado que pré-configura essas variáveis (como documentado no exemplo em README.gz) ou usar os scripts vpnc-script-connect-action e vpnc-script-disconnect-action para definir separadamente (veja abaixo), que pode ou não ser desejado, dependendo da sua configuração. Ou você pode ligá-los simbolicamente para ter a mesma configuração nas duas fases.

O mesmo se aplica à desativação da atualização de dados do DNS. Os métodos antigos são preservado com wrappers de compatibilidade para o futuro próximo, mas deve ser evitado com novas instalações.

    
por 07.04.2011 / 16:27

Tags